The Composition of Ferrous Bisglycinate
Ferrous bisglycinate is a chelated form of iron, specifically ferrous (Fe2+) iron, which is bound to two molecules of the amino acid glycine. This chelation process enhances the absorption of iron in the body, making it an effective option for individuals with iron deficiency or those looking to maintain healthy iron levels.
Key Components:
1. Ferrous Iron: The ferrous form of iron is more absorbable than its ferric counterpart. It is essential for various bodily functions, including oxygen transport, energy production, and DNA synthesis.
2. Glycine: Glycine is a non-essential amino acid that plays a vital role in the synthesis of proteins and other important compounds in the body. Its presence in ferrous bisglycinate aids in the chelation process, improving the stability and solubility of iron.
How is Ferrous Bisglycinate Made?
The process of creating ferrous bisglycinate involves combining ferrous sulfate or ferrous fumarate with glycine through a chelation reaction. This method ensures that the iron is effectively bound to the amino acid, resulting in a stable and bioavailable compound. The final product is often in the form of a powder or capsule, making it convenient for supplementation.
Benefits of Ferrous Bisglycinate
1. Enhanced Absorption: The chelated form of iron in ferrous bisglycinate allows for better absorption in the intestines compared to traditional iron supplements, reducing the likelihood of gastrointestinal discomfort.
2. Reduced Side Effects: Many individuals experience side effects like constipation and nausea when taking standard iron supplements. Ferrous bisglycinate is known to be gentler on the stomach, making it a preferred choice for those sensitive to other forms of iron.
3. Support for Iron Deficiency: For those diagnosed with iron deficiency anemia or those at risk (such as pregnant women, vegetarians, and athletes), ferrous bisglycinate provides an effective solution for increasing iron levels in the body.
4. Versatile Use: Beyond addressing iron deficiency, ferrous bisglycinate can support overall health, including immune function, energy production, and cognitive performance.
